После года разработки опубликован выпуск коммуникационного клиента Dino 0.4, поддерживающего чат, аудиовызовы, видеовызовы, видеоконференции и обмен текстовыми сообщениями с использованием протокола Jabber/XMPP Программа совместима с различными клиентами и серверами XMPP, ориентирована на обеспечение конфиденциальности переговоров и поддерживает сквозное шифрование. Код проекта написан на языке Vala с использованием тулкита GTK и распространяется под лицензией GPLv3+.
Для организации соединения используется протокол XMPP и типовые расширения XMPP (XEP-0353, XEP-0167), что позволяет совершать вызовы между Dino и любыми другими клиентами XMPP, поддерживающими соответствующие спецификации, например, возможна установка шифрованных видеовызовов с приложениями Conversations и Movim, а также незашифрованных вызовов с приложением Gajim. Сквозное шифрование обмена сообщениями и подтверждение достоверности осуществляется с применением XMPP-расширения OMEMO на базе протокола Signal.
Na mwepụta ọhụrụ:
- Добавлена поддержка реакций, дающих пользователю возможность быстро отреагировать на сообщение подходящим emoji-символом, например, выразить эмоции (🤯), согласие (👍️) или неодобрение (👎️) без набора текста.
- В групповых чатах, прямом обмене сообщениями и каналах добавлена поддержка прямого ответа, привязанного к конкретному сообщению и позволяющего быстро перейти к его просмотру.
- Осуществлён переход с GTK3 на GTK4 и библиотеку libadwaita, которая предлагает готовые виджеты и объекты для построения приложений, соответствующие новым рекомендациям GNOME HIG (Human Interface Guidelines). Пользовательский интерфейс адаптирован для корректной работы на экранах любого размера, в том числе для небольших экранов мобильных устройств.
Основные возможности Dino и поддерживаемые XEP-расширения:
- Mkparịta ụka ọtụtụ ndị ọrụ na nkwado maka otu nzuzo na ọwa ọha (n'ime otu ị nwere ike ịkparịta ụka naanị na ndị mmadụ gụnyere n'ime otu na isiokwu aka ike, na ọwa ọ bụla ndị ọrụ nwere ike ikwurịta okwu naanị na isiokwu enyere);
- Iji avatars;
- Njikwa ebe nchekwa ozi;
- Ịka akara ikpeazụ natara na gụọ ozi na nkata;
- Na-agbakwụnye faịlụ na onyonyo na ozi. Enwere ike ịnyefe faịlụ ozugbo site na onye ahịa gaa na onye ahịa ma ọ bụ site na-ebugote na ihe nkesa na ịnye njikọ nke onye ọrụ ọzọ nwere ike ibudata faịlụ a;
- Поддержка прямой передачи мультимедийного контента (звук, видео, файлы) между клиентами при помощи протокола Jingle;
- Nkwado maka ndekọ SRV iji guzobe njikọ ezoro ezo kpọmkwem site na iji TLS, na mgbakwunye na izipu site na ihe nkesa XMPP;
- Izo ya ezo site na iji OMEMO na OpenPGP;
- Nkesa ozi site na ndenye aha (Bipụta-Subscribe);
- Ịma ọkwa banyere ọkwa nke onye ọrụ ọzọ pịnye (ị nwere ike gbanyụọ izipu ngosi banyere dee n'ihe metụtara nkata ma ọ bụ onye ọrụ);
- Nzipu ozi akwụsịla;
- Закладки на различные сервисы и ресурсы, хранимые на сервере;
- Ịma ọkwa nke nnyefe ozi na-aga nke ọma;
- Ụzọ dị elu nke ịchọ ozi na nzacha nzacha n'ime akụkọ ozi;
- Nkwado maka ịrụ ọrụ n'otu interface nwere ọtụtụ akaụntụ, dịka ọmụmaatụ, ikewapụ ọrụ na akwụkwọ ozi onwe onye;
- Na-arụ ọrụ na ọnọdụ offline na izipu ozi edere na ịnata ozi agbakọbara na sava mgbe njikọ netwọk pụtara;
- Nkwado SOCKS5 maka iziga njikọ P2P kpọmkwem;
- Nkwado maka usoro XML vCard.
isi: opennet.ru